Board approves higher athletic trip fees for 2025–26; district says increase driven by data

The Mount Vernon Community School board voted 5-0 to raise athletic trip fees to $75 for high school and $40 for middle school trips, citing historical cost data and the need to eliminate a deficit in the program.

The Mount Vernon Community School board approved an increase in athletic transportation fees Thursday, raising the charge to $75 for high school trips and $40 for middle school trips beginning immediately.
